What Does YFM Meaning in Text Stand For? (Definition & Origin)
The Simple Definition
YFM most commonly stands for:
You Feel Me
Itâs a casual way of asking someone if they understand, agree, or relate to what youâre saying.
Itâs similar to saying:
- âDo you get what I mean?â
- âYou understand?â
- âRight?â
- âKnow what Iâm saying?â
The Tone Behind YFM
Unlike formal phrases, YFM carries a relaxed, friendly, and sometimes street-style tone. Itâs often used to:
- Emphasize a point
- Build connection
- Check for agreement
- Sound cool or conversational
For example:
âThat movie was low-key underrated, YFM?â
In this case, the sender isnât just asking if you understand theyâre inviting you to agree.
Where Did YFM Come From?
The phrase âYou feel me?â has been popular in hip-hop culture for decades. Artists like Tupac Shakur and Jay-Z frequently used similar expressions in lyrics and interviews.
As texting culture grew in the 2000s and 2010s, longer phrases were shortened. Just like:
- âLaughing Out Loudâ â LOL
- âBe Right Backâ â BRB
âYou feel me?â became YFM.

Common Mistakes or Misunderstandings
Even though YFM meaning in text is simple, itâs sometimes misunderstood.
1. Confusing It With Other Acronyms
Some people mistake YFM for:
- âYour Favorite Musicâ
- âYoung Future Millionaireâ
- Random brand names
But in texting culture, YFM = You Feel Me 90% of the time.
2. Using It in Formal Situations
Avoid using YFM in:
- Work emails
- Academic writing
- Professional LinkedIn messages
Example of what NOT to do:
âPlease submit the report by Friday, YFM?â
That would sound unprofessional.
3. Overusing It
Using YFM after every sentence can feel forced.
â âItâs hot today, YFM? I need water, YFM? Letâs go inside, YFM?â
Moderation is key.

Related Slangs and Abbreviations
If youâre learning YFM meaning in text, youâll probably see these too:
1. FR
For Real
âThat was crazy, FR.â
2. ONG
On God
Used to emphasize truth.
âI didnât touch it, ONG.â
3. NGL
Not Gonna Lie
âNGL, that was impressive.â
4. SMH
Shaking My Head
Expresses disappointment.
5. IMO
In My Opinion
6. WYD
What You Doing?

FAQs About YFM Meaning
1. What does YFM mean in text messages?
YFM means âYou Feel Me?â Itâs a casual way to ask if someone understands or agrees.
2. Is YFM rude?
No. Itâs informal but not rude. Tone depends on context.
3. Can girls use YFM?
Absolutely. Itâs gender-neutral slang.
4. Is YFM only used in hip-hop culture?
It started there but is now mainstream in texting and social media.
5. Is YFM outdated in 2026?
No, but newer slang competes with it.
6. Can YFM mean something else?
In rare cases, yes. But in chat conversations, it almost always means You Feel Me.
7. Should I use YFM in professional settings?
No. Keep it for casual communication.
8. Whatâs the difference between YFM and âI feel youâ?
- YFM asks for understanding.
- I feel you shows understanding.
